University of Oxford

The University of Oxford is a research-focused collegiate university located in Oxford, England. It has a rich history of teaching that dates back to 1096, making it the oldest university in the English-speaking world and the second-oldest university still in operation globally. The university saw significant growth starting in 1167 when King Henry II prohibited English students from attending the University of Paris. In 1209, following conflicts between students and the local residents of Oxford, some scholars moved northeast to establish what would later become the University of Cambridge. Today, these two historic institutions are often collectively known as Oxbridge, as they share many similarities.
